Flash Actionscript to control turning knobs

Completed Posted Oct 31, 2010 Paid on delivery
Completed Paid on delivery

I have made a small animation that needs actionscript to control it. Basically, it is 2 radio-like knobs/dials that when turned control the flow of text objects (the text objects are the name of gases like oxygen [ie. O2], or isoflurane [iso]). I need someone to write script that does the following: when the user uses the mouse to turn a knob, O2 flows faster down a pipe, and when the user turns another knob, O2 flows fast down another pipe. In essence the user can control how fast the oxygen molecules are flowing down the pipes by turning one of two knobs up or down.

I have the basic cartoon made, but i don't know how to write the script. This project would likely take one day for someone who knows how do write this.

More details (see attached jpg and flash file): when the green knob is turned to 1, a little bobbin above it will float up to 1 and 1 molecule of O2 will move down the pipe and across to the other side in about 5 seconds (from the dial on the left out through the pipe to the right). If the user turns the knob to 5, then 5 molecules will move down the pipe in 5 seconds. When the user turns the green knob then O2 will move into a large chamber that has liquid (iso) in the bottom. The O2 will float around inside the chamber and 1 molecule of liquid iso will vaporize out of the liquid to join 2 molecules of O2 in the chamber; together they will flow out of the chamber through the exiting pipe. These molecules should just be represented by the shorthand (O2, iso).

An example: The user turns the green dial up to 5 (5L/min) and little O2 symbols start flowing out at a steady rate (a good rate would be 1 per second). The user then turns on the red dial up to 0.1 (100ml/min) and little O2 symbols start to flow out at a slower rate (a good rate would be 1 every 5 seconds or so). Once a few O2 symbols have entered the big chamber, 2 of them draw near each other and a little "iso" symbol pops out of the liquid to join them (the liquid is isoflurane that gets vaporized when oxygen comes close by). Together the 2 O2's and the iso exit as a threesome. If the red dial is turned up more, this process just occurs with more molecules (ie 1 per second instead of every 5 seconds). All the molecules that have exited the right side of the chamber flow out the pipes and disappear on the right.

small details:

The running animation should be looping and able to be paused and played.

The green dial should read 0-5 (not 0-3 as I have it in the example picture)

The bobbins should rise up inside the glass to the level that the dials are turned (the center horizontal line represents the level on the bobbin that should be level with the meter).

Ideally both dials should be green to represent oxygen in both lines.

ActionScript Adobe Flash

Project ID: #839810

About the project

4 proposals Remote project Active Nov 1, 2010

Awarded to:

dasilva1

please check pm thanks

$40 USD in 1 day
(76 Reviews)
5.4

4 freelancers are bidding on average $113 for this job

Igo150

hi, check inbox

$120 USD in 1 day
(146 Reviews)
7.2
logoDS761

Excellent flash: Websites, AS2-AS3, XML, any Template modification, check PM.

$40 USD in 1 day
(15 Reviews)
4.6
Kanyal

Hi expert in as3 and flash related stuff. let do your job quickly

$250 USD in 5 days
(2 Reviews)
3.6